Palestine campaigners march in Margate after Landmark council vote

PALESTINE campaigners in Thanet marched through Margate on Saturday after the local council passed a landmark motion calling for a ceasefire in Gaza.

Following the march, the campaigners gathered at a meeting where former ANC MP Andrew Feinstein delivered a speech.

Mr Feinstein recounted Nelson Mandela’s words upon his release from prison in 1990: “There is much work to do because our freedom is incomplete until the Palestinians are free.”
